Who Is the I? Knowing Our Nature: By Dr. Harsh K. Luthar

Wednesday, April 8th, 2009

The practice of advanced yoga methods and pranayama with discipline along with meditation on the Chakras (Energy Centers in the body) leads to various mental and spiritual experiences. Sri Ramana’s teaching, however, views such yogic and meditative practices as preliminary to the real quest into the investigation of the nature of the “I”.
